In other Hoka shoes, I have found that a size 10.5 W worked, but these shoes were too long for me. Also, I read this was a neutral shoe, yet in the center of the shoe was some sort of square or rectangular hard area that felt like all my weight was focused on the center of the shoe while my heel and toe area were just left hanging out there. I really liked the mixed white and black color scheme, but this shoe was just not for me. I had tried another Hoka shoe that was perfect for me, but it didn't have a padded tongue so there was no protection for the top of my foot. Anyway, back to the drawing board for me.

I really wanted these to work. The color is phenomenal, and obvious good construction. The inner ankle was hitting my ankle bone and super painful. Also, the toe box is extremely narrow, pinching my big toe in. The bounce is great, the color is great, and the craftsmanship seems solid. I would say this shoe would be great for someone with narrow feet and a high arch, with a high midstep volume.
